3-х месячный онлайн-практикум
Системный аналитик: с нуля до опыта работы на проекте

СТАРТ ПОТОКА 
скоро анонсируем

13 модулей

6 воркшопов

Доступ 12 месяцев

Программа обучения

Практический вебинар - занятие в режиме онлайн, в соответствии с расписанием, на котором вы знакомитесь с теорией, практикуетесь решать задачи и задаете вопросы преподавателю. Для тех, кто не сможет присутствовать онлайн, запись будет доступна в платформе.

Воркшоп - занятие в режиме онлайн, на котором вы с командой практикуете полученные навыки в режиме онлайн и сразу же получаете обратную связь от преподавателя.

Модуль 1.
Сбор требований: погружение в проект

1. Заказ на разработку IT-продукта
2. Исследование предметной области
3. Описание бизнес-процессов AS IS и TO BE

Модуль 2.
Анализ требований: с чего начать

Погружение в предметную область:  
1. Знакомство с проектом и требованиями заказчика
2. Формулирование цели и задач проекта в бизнес-контексте  
3. Формулирование миссии проекта
4. Выделение ключевых возможностей, ролей пользователей

Модуль 2.
Анализ требований: виды требований и методики выявления

1. Проект и его миссия      
2. Методы и методики выявления требований            
3. Знакомство с видами требований 

Модуль 3.
Бизнес-требования и User Stories

1.  Бизнес-требования, правила и ограничения          
2. Требования пользователей  
3. User Story  
4. Связь бизнес-требований и User Stories
5. Отличия в работе с системами “с нуля” и с рабочими продуктами  
6. Практика формулирования бизнес-требований и User Stories. 

Модуль 3.
Моделирование бизнес-процессов в BPMN

Описание бизнес-процессов в нотации моделирования BPMN. Практика.

Модуль 3.
Бизнес-требования и User Stories

Командная работа по применению практических навыков. Применение на практике, в моменте, освоенных знаний

Модуль 4.
Функциональные и нефункциональные требования. Use Cases

1. Функциональные и нефункциональные требования          
2. Связь БТ, ФТ и НФТ  
3. Use Cases    
4. Связь User Story и Use Case                
5. Как превратить ФТ в Use Cases        
6. Практика: ФТ, НФТ, UC 

Модуль 4.
Функциональные и нефункциональные требования. Use Cases

Командная работа по применению практических навыков

Модуль 5.
Формирование ТЗ на разработку системы

1. Что писать в ТЗ    
2. Разбор ГОСТ-34 и его применение на практике  
3. Откуда смотреть: роли или компоненты системы  
4. Как ТЗ превращают в задачи на разработку  
5. Создание и наполнение шаблона ТЗ

Модуль 5.
Ошибки при формулировании требований

1. Виды ошибок  
2. Тестирование: выбираем корректные формулировки
3. Практика: в прямом эфире вы пишете БТ, ФТ, НФТ и мы вместе разбираем ошибки и предлагаем лучшие решения

Модуль 6.
Инструменты для сбора и описания требований

1. Инструменты для хранения и разработки требований: Word, Confluence, Notion, Miro, Draw.io          
2. Инструменты для управления проектом: Jira

Модуль 1-5.
Разбор домашних заданий

Общая встреча, на которой разбираем индивидуально результаты работы с домашними заданиями предыдущих уроков.

*Встреча доступна только для участников тарифа с наставничеством

Модуль 7.
Проектирование UI/UX: дизайнер + аналитик

1. Подходы к созданию крутого UI/UX силами аналитика  
2. Гайд-дизайна для команды
3. Стандартные библиотеки
4. Разбор инструментов: Draw.io, Microsof Visio, Figma, Axure RP Pro

Модуль 6-7.
Инструменты для сбора и описания требований. Проектирование UI/UX

Командная работа по применению практических навыков. Confluence, Jira, Figma, Axure RP Pro

Модуль 8.
Проектирование БД: детализация требований и постановка задач на разработку

1. Как БД влияет на функциональные требования проекта
2. Концептуальный, логический и физический уровни модели БД  
3. Постановка задачи на разработку: шаблон Confluence и задачи в Jira  
4. Как действовать, если мы дорабатываем существующую БД
5. Правила соблюдения обратной совместимости

Модуль 8.
Воркшоп: Проектирование БД

Командная работа:  
Разработка логической и физической моделей БД. Постановка задач на разработчиков в Jira+Confluence

Модуль 9.
Backend: детализация требований и постановка задач на разработку

1. Клиент-серверное взаимодействие
2. Верхнеуровневое описание архитектуры решения: схема взаимодействия компонентов  
3. Для чего разрабатывают API. Базовые знания о REST API      
4. Постановка задач на разработчиков: фуллстек и бэкенд
5. Разработка шаблона требований

Модуль 9.
Разработка требований для Backend

Командная работа:
1. Тестирование REST API через Postman  
2. Постановка задачи на разработку REST API в Confluence

Модуль 10.
Frontend: детализация требований и постановка задач на разработку для веб-приложений

1. Клиент-серверное взаимодействие
2. Верхнеуровневое описание архитектуры решения: схема взаимодействия компонентов    
 3. Работа с консолью браузера. Сценарии использования          
4. Требования к UI/UX      
5. Постановка задач на разработчиков    
6. Разработка шаблона требований

Модуль 10.
Mobile: детализация требований и постановка задач на разработку

1. Особенности разработки мобильных приложений. Сценарии использования  
2. Применение UML-диаграмм    
3. Требования к UI/UX
4. Постановка задач на разработчиков  
5. Разработка шаблона требований

Модуль 6-10.
Разбор домашних заданий

Общая встреча, на которой разбираем индивидуально результаты работы с домашними заданиями предыдущих уроков.

*Встреча доступна только для участников тарифа с наставничеством

Модуль 10.
Frontend и Mobile

Командная работа:    
Детализация требований и постановка задач на разработку для веб- и мобильных приложений

Модуль 11.
Интеграции: детализация требований и постановка задач на разработку

1. Подход к анализу требований.    
2. Анализ протоколов интеграций с внешними системами  
3. Описание интеграционных сценариев с применением UML    
4. Маппинг данных    
5. Постановка задач на разработчиков  
6. Разработка шаблона требований.

Модуль 12.
Создание проектной документации

1. Как превращать требования в документацию    
2. Ошибки дублирования: CTRL+C и CTRL+V
3. Как бороться с противоречиями: проблема Word + Confluence  
4. Шаблоны документации.

Модуль 12.
Хранение и актуализация проектной документации

1.Способы организации хранения требований и проектной документации в Confluence  
2. Поддержка документации в актуальном состоянии. Вовлечение в процесс работы с документацией команды разработки

Модуль 13.
Подготовка резюме

1.  Софт-скилы аналитика
2. Площадки для размещения резюме
3. Создание резюме
4. Процесс найма
5. Собеседования

Модуль 10-12.
Разбор домашних заданий

Общая встреча, на которой разбираем индивидуально результаты работы с домашними заданиями предыдущих уроков.

*Встреча доступна только для участников тарифа с наставничеством

Модуль 13.
Собеседование

Разбор резюме. Групповое собеседование и обзор тестовых заданий

ЗАПИСАТЬСЯ НА КОНСУЛЬТАЦИЮ

Имя *
EMAIL *
Телефон *
Вопрос

Контакты

+7 (499) 686-15-46

*Instagram — запрещенная на территории РФ организация

Практический опыт здесь, 2021-2024

Мы используем файлы cookie, для персонализации сервисов и повышения удобства пользования сайтом. Если вы не согласны на их использование, поменяйте настройки браузера.